Describing Cellulite

Although cellulite is structurally the same as regular fat (adipose tissue), it builds up in a very different way. For cellulite, fat is layered in globular pockets under the skin, held in place by rigid connective tissues. The lumpy pockets of fat give cellulite its cobblestone appearance.

Cellulite is not broken down through diet or exercise the way normal fat deposits are. One theory holds that toxins and fluids are trapped in the pockets, which impair metabolism and keep the fat from being broken up. Additionally, cellulite production is tied to hormones, specifically estrogen, so things that cause hormone fluctuations – like pregnancy, puberty, menopause, even stress – can cause cellulite. Where and at what rate cellulite is formed is different for every person.

Diet and exercise can improve the situation somewhat by keeping overall body fat down and by keeping the underlying muscle firm. But even diet and exercise cannot remove, or improve, cellulite. Since cellulite doesn’t really go away, the appearance of cellulite gets worse over time, as more deposits build up.
